摘 要:采用LC-MS/MS真菌毒素检测法,对尼日利亚纳萨拉瓦州市场出售的食物作物(灌木芒果(n=12)、烤腰果(n=12)、干秋葵(n=12)、芝麻(n=35)、高粱(n=36))进行了分析研究。结果显示具致肝癌性黄曲霉毒素B1在灌木芒果、干秋葵和高粱样品中检出率分别为42%、25%和19%,其平均浓度分别为19.2、8.27和4.75μg/kg,伏马毒素B1污染了9%的芝麻样品(平均浓度为12.5μg/kg)和47%的高粱样品(平均浓度为461μg/kg);同时受到黄曲霉毒素B1和伏马毒素B1污染的高粱样本至少有19%。灌木芒果、高粱和干秋葵中检测到了具致肾毒性的赭曲霉毒素A,这是首次在干秋葵中报道检测到该毒素。可见,当地市场出售的这些食物作物受到真菌毒素的污染,可能威胁消费者的健康,需要采取积极措施防控污染。Food crops(bush mango(n=12),roasted cashew nut(n=12),dried okra(n=12),sesame(n=35)and sorghum(n=36))sold in markets in Nasarawa state,Nigeria,were analyzed using a LC-MS/MS mycotoxin method.The hepatocarcinogenic aflatoxin B1 was detected in 42%,25%and 19%of bush mango,dried okra and sorghum samples at mean concentrations of 19.2,8.27 and 4.75μg/kg,respectively,while fumonisin B1 contaminated 9%of the sesame(mean:12.5μg/kg)and 47%of the sorghum(mean:461μg/kg)samples.At least 19%of the sorghum samples were co-contaminated with aflatoxin B1 andfumonisin B1.The nephrotoxic ochratoxin A was detected in bush mango,sorghum and,for the first time to the best of our knowledge,in dried okra.These vended food crops in the local markets are therefore prone to mycotoxin contamination,which may pose a health threat to consumers,and require intentional mitigation efforts.
